Sewer/ Water Line Replacement
It’s easy to believe that once the water flows down your drain, it’s out of your life for good. Although that’s partially true but water does have to travel somewhere. If you’re having problems with your sewer or water lines, then you’ll notice that the “somewhere” is often back inside the house or bubbling up from the ground. Water line and sewer repairs and replacements are required in the event that pipes running from your home to the mainline fail due to the effects of age or an obvious tree root.
Tests to detect odors
The smells of a house that are unpleasant are a source of irritation but they also present a risk to your safety too. We can determine the cause of the smells using electronic means or by the use of a smoking test. Through a smoke test, the smoke is injected into the plumbing system of your home to determine the exact place where gases and water leave your pipes or the point at which unwelcome rainwater gets into. Backflow Prevention Repairs and Installations
The majority of people don’t even think about backflow prevention until it’s late , which is in this case, you’re bathing or drinking the water that is contaminated. Testing for backflow preventers isn’t only suggested, but in many regions, it’s mandatory by state and local authorities. Backflow systems are essential to ensure that wastewater doesn’t get sucked back into your “good water” supply.
The installation of Flood Protection Systems
Another factor that is usually not considered until later is flood protection systems for flood protection. These kinds of systems extend beyond sump pumps, however. Systems that make use of switches and sensors make use of shut-off valves on areas like refrigerators, sinks as well as washers, water heaters and toilets to recognize the presence of water in a different amount and then trigger the appropriate steps to stop a significant amount of damage that could result from the water.
